What’s a Gold IRA?
A Gold IRA is a sort of self-directed Individual Retirement Account that allows traders to hold physical gold, silver, platinum, and palladium in their retirement portfolios. Not like conventional IRAs, which typically include stocks, bonds, and mutual funds, Gold IRAs provide an opportunity to invest in tangible belongings that traditionally retain their value, especially throughout financial downturns.

Advantages of Gold IRAs
- Diversification: Gold IRAs permit traders to diversify their retirement portfolios past conventional property. This diversification can reduce total risk and improve the potential for returns.
- Inflation Hedge: Gold has traditionally maintained its worth during inflationary periods. By including gold of their retirement accounts, investors can protect their purchasing power.
- Tax Benefits: Gold IRAs supply related tax advantages to traditional IRAs. Contributions could also be tax-deductible, and features on the investment can develop tax-deferred until withdrawal.
- Tangible Asset: In contrast to stocks and bonds, gold is a physical asset that investors can hold. This tangibility can present a sense of safety, particularly during times of financial uncertainty.
Drawbacks of Gold IRAs
- Higher Charges: Gold IRAs typically include higher fees compared to traditional IRAs. These fees can embrace setup fees, storage charges, and administration fees, which may eat into investment returns.
- Restricted Development Potential: Whereas gold can present stability, it doesn’t generate income like dividends or interest. This lack of cash flow is usually a drawback for buyers looking for growth.
- Regulatory Restrictions: The IRS has particular guidelines relating to the types of gold and treasured metals that can be held in a Gold IRA. Buyers should guarantee their assets meet these requirements to keep away from penalties.
- Storage and Safety: Bodily gold must be stored in an accredited depository, which adds one other layer of complexity to managing a Gold IRA. Making certain the safety of these property is paramount.
